A video showing Senators waiting for the Abuja Electricity Distribution PLC (Disco) to restore electricity before the commencement of session has elicited conflicting views online.
There was a partial blackout in the Red Chamber today, causing senators to wait until the power was restored.
Following the restoration of electricity a few minutes later, Senate President Godswill Akpabio convened the plenary session.
It is worth remembering that in February, the Abuja energy Distribution PLC issued a warning to cut the energy supply to 86 Ministries, Departments, and Agencies (MDAs) due to an outstanding debt of N47.1 billion.
Some of the MDAs comprise the Ministry of Finance, Information, Budget, Works and Housing, barracks, Nigeria Police Force, Presidential Villa, CBN Governor,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C), Federal Inland Revenue Service (FIRS), Federal Airports Authority of Nigeria (FAAN), and state liaison offices in the Federal Capital Territory (FCT).
